 Introduction: Understanding NDR in the Cybersecurity Landscape

In today's digital age, the importance of network security cannot be overstated. With cyber threats evolving at a rapid pace, organizations are increasingly turning to Network Detection and Response (NDR) solutions to safeguard their networks against sophisticated attacks. NDR encompasses a range of technologies and strategies designed to detect and mitigate threats in real-time, offering organizations greater visibility and control over their network traffic.

Trends Shaping the NDR Market

Several trends are shaping the landscape of the Network Detection and Response (NDR) , including the proliferation of cloud-based services and the rise of remote work. As organizations adopt cloud infrastructure and services, the need for cloud-compatible NDR solutions becomes paramount to ensure comprehensive threat detection and response across hybrid environments. Additionally, the shift towards remote work has expanded the attack surface, necessitating adaptive NDR capabilities that can protect distributed networks and endpoints effectively.

Challenges in Implementing NDR Solutions

Despite the benefits of NDR solutions, organizations face various challenges when implementing them. One major challenge is the complexity of network environments, which can make it difficult to deploy and manage NDR solutions effectively. Additionally, the volume and sophistication of cyber threats continue to increase, requiring NDR solutions to keep pace with evolving attack techniques and tactics. Furthermore, ensuring compatibility and integration with existing security infrastructure remains a key consideration for organizations looking to invest in NDR solutions.

Key Considerations for Selecting NDR Solutions

When selecting NDR solutions, organizations must consider several factors to ensure they meet their cybersecurity needs effectively. Scalability is essential to accommodate growing network traffic and evolving threat landscapes, allowing organizations to scale their NDR capabilities as needed. Real-time threat detection and response capabilities are also critical for minimizing dwell time and mitigating the impact of cyber attacks. Additionally, ease of deployment and integration with existing security tools can streamline the implementation process and enhance overall security posture.

The Future of NDR: Innovations and Opportunities

Looking ahead, the future of the NDR market holds promise for continued innovation and growth. Advances in artificial intelligence and machine learning are driving improvements in threat detection accuracy and efficiency, enabling NDR solutions to adapt to emerging threats in real-time. Moreover, the convergence of NDR with other security technologies, such as Endpoint Detection and Response (EDR) and Security Information and Event Management (SIEM), offers organizations comprehensive visibility and control over their security posture.
